Transaction 39ad87ff2ad4f83ecd8d8c322c5c61020fdf5bc317bad315a95aaae453a05149
1 Input
1 Output
-
39ad87ff2ad4f83ecd8d8c322c5c61020fdf5bc317bad315a95aaae453a05149:0
- value
- 62866
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8f5225822ff2ac4baf0b76514389ec96ce7f2ead OP_EQUAL
- address
- 3EkpxcfCGVeZu8G6sumfUKrNLYQ2skuAHB